Detta kommer att visa dig hur man läser en webbsida från ett Python-skript ges en webbadress . Instruktioner
1
Installera python byggare härifrån . Det är gratis .
Http://www.python.org/download/releases/2.5.2/
2
När du har installerat Python du kan köra det från början meny Review
Python 2.5 - IDLE ( Python GUI ) Addera 3
När programmet öppnas , ser det ut som anteckningsblock . Välj File från menyn överst och Nytt fönster . Detta kommer att öppna en ny text fönster som du kan spara din python -kod till .
4
# Kopiera följande kod i det nya fönstret som just öppnat .
Import shutilimport osimport timeimport datetimeimport mathimport urllibfrom array import array
filehandle = urllib.urlopen ( ' http://www.loothog.com ' ) katalog
för linjer i filehandle.readlines ( ) : print linjer
filehandle.close ( )
5
Välj Arkiv - . . Spara och namnge din fil vad du vill
6
Tryck F5 för att köra din kod
att stoppa program från att köras , klicka på det första fönstret som öppnas och välj från menyn Shell - Starta Shell
7
Du kan spara alla dessa rader i en textfil genom att modifiera koden att se ut så här
myFile = open ( ' test.html ' , ' w ' ) för linjer i filehandle.readlines ( ) : . print linesmyFile.write ( rader ) katalog
myFile.close ( ) filehandle.close ( )
8
Kanske har du några aktiekurser som ser ut som thisAAAC , D , 20071210,8.2,8.2,8.2,9.5,1000
och du vill att få 9,5 close priset , så du kan dela line up av kommatecken och åt bara 9,5 så här
myFile = open ( ' test.html ' , ' w ' ) för linjer i filehandle.readlines ( ) : avsnitt = lines.split ( ' , ' ) print Str ( ) omvandlar tal till en sträng och . Strip ( ) tar bort extra blanksteg i slutet .